Royal of Fairhaven Nursing Center
Royal of Fairhaven Nursing Center is a 107-bed nursing home in FAIRHAVEN, Massachusetts. CMS has certified it for Medicare and Medicaid since 1970-11-01. It averages 73.0 residents a day.
What harm was found in the violations cited at Royal of Fairhaven Nursing Center?
CMS lists 17 health-inspection deficiencies for Royal of Fairhaven Nursing Center since 2021-11-03, 8 of them in the three years to 2026-08-01: the highest scope-and-severity letter on record is G; the most recent health inspection was 2025-03-03.

Who owns Royal of Fairhaven Nursing Center, and what chain is it in?
Royal of Fairhaven Nursing Center is registered with CMS as For profit - Limited Liability company, operates under the legal business name 184 MAIN LLC and belongs to the ROYAL HEALTH GROUP chain.
